Thermal management is an essential part of keeping electronic devices from overheating and becoming damaged, and 621A Heat Sinks are designed to help maximize the safety and performance of various electronic components. A Heat Sink is a device that absorbs and dissipates heat from a specific area, usually electronics, to keep them cooler and to prevent damage. In the case of 621A Heat Sinks, these are designed specifically for thermal management of electronics, with several key features.

621A Heat Sink Working Principle
The 621A Heat Sink works by absorbing and dissipating heat from the device it is attached to. This is done by having large surface area which increases the exchange surface between the Heat Sink and the device. This allows the Heat Sink to absorb the heat as quickly and efficiently as possible. The fin design also helps to increase the surface area and disperses the heat more evenly across the Heat Sink. The Heat Sink is then cooled down by air flow or by a forced convection system. This helps to keep the device cool and prevents it from being damaged.
